Unlocking Business Potential Through Salesforce Integration Services

Businesses across various industries are continuously exploring innovative ways to enhance their operations and streamline processes. Salesforce, a leading Customer Relationship Management (CRM) platform, provides a comprehensive suite of tools to handle customer interactions, sales pipelines, website and marketing campaigns. However, to truly leverage the power of Salesforce, seamless integration with other critical business systems is essential. Leveraging Salesforce integration services enables organizations to break down data silos, foster greater collaboration, and unlock new levels of efficiency.

By connecting Salesforce with applications such as en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ems, email marketing platforms, and e-commerce solutions, businesses can achieve a unified view of customer data. This holistic perspective empowers teams to make more informed decisions, personalize customer experiences, and drive revenue growth. Moreover, Salesforce integration services can automate repetitive tasks, decrease manual errors, and improve overall productivity.
